John Zachman is Dead, Long Live John Zachman

by Philip Allega  |  September 1, 2010  |  15 Comments

Typically, the world of EA is boring. In this last few weeks, all bets are off as John Zachman goes to court and questions are raised about the near term and long term effects to the commercialization of EA Frameworks and the EA certification marketplace. It’s still early days, but challenges from the “father of EA” require consideration.
